// Get gets metric values for a single metric
// Parameters:
// appID - ID of the application. This is Application ID from the API Access settings blade in the Azure
// portal.
// metricID - ID of the metric. This is either a standard AI metric, or an application-specific custom metric.
// timespan - the timespan over which to retrieve metric values. This is an ISO8601 time period value. If
// timespan is omitted, a default time range of `PT12H` ("last 12 hours") is used. The actual timespan that is
// queried may be adjusted by the server based. In all cases, the actual time span used for the query is
// included in the response.
// interval - the time interval to use when retrieving metric values. This is an ISO8601 duration. If interval
// is omitted, the metric value is aggregated across the entire timespan. If interval is supplied, the server
// may adjust the interval to a more appropriate size based on the timespan used for the query. In all cases,
// the actual interval used for the query is included in the response.
// aggregation - the aggregation to use when computing the metric values. To retrieve more than one aggregation
// at a time, separate them with a comma. If no aggregation is specified, then the default aggregation for the
// metric is used.
// segment - the name of the dimension to segment the metric values by. This dimension must be applicable to
// the metric you are retrieving. To segment by more than one dimension at a time, separate them with a comma
// (,). In this case, the metric data will be segmented in the order the dimensions are listed in the
// parameter.
// top - the number of segments to return. This value is only valid when segment is specified.
// orderby - the aggregation function and direction to sort the segments by. This value is only valid when
// segment is specified.
// filter - an expression used to filter the results. This value should be a valid OData filter expression
// where the keys of each clause should be applicable dimensions for the metric you are retrieving.
